Felix Kuehling
5e56935b51 drm/amdgpu: Don't pin VRAM without DMABUF_MOVE_NOTIFY
Pinning of VRAM is for peer devices that don't support dynamic attachment
and move notifiers. But it requires that all such peer devices are able to
access VRAM via PCIe P2P. Any device without P2P access requires migration
to GTT, which fails if the memory is already pinned for another peer
device.

Sharing between GPUs should not require pinning in VRAM. However, if
DMABUF_MOVE_NOTIFY is disabled in the kernel build, even DMABufs shared
between GPUs must be pinned, which can lead to failures and functional
regressions on systems where some peer GPUs are not P2P accessible.

Disable VRAM pinning if move notifiers are disabled in the kernel build
to fix regressions when sharing BOs between GPUs.

Matthew Auld
25583ad42d drm/xe/dma_buf: stop relying on placement in unmap
The is_vram() is checking the current placement, however if we consider
exported VRAM with dynamic dma-buf, it looks possible for the xe driver
to async evict the memory, notifying the importer, however importer does
not have to call unmap_attachment() immediately, but rather just as
"soon as possible", like when the dma-resv idles. Following from this we
would then pipeline the move, attaching the fence to the manager, and
then update the current placement. But when the unmap_attachment() runs
at some later point we might see that is_vram() is now false, and take
the complete wrong path when dma-unmapping the sg, leading to
explosions.

To fix this check if the sgl was mapping a struct page.

Matthew Auld
2577b20245 drm/xe/userptr: fix notifier vs folio deadlock
User is reporting what smells like notifier vs folio deadlock, where
migrate_pages_batch() on core kernel side is holding folio lock(s) and
then interacting with the mappings of it, however those mappings are
tied to some userptr, which means calling into the notifier callback and
grabbing the notifier lock. With perfect timing it looks possible that
the pages we pulled from the hmm fault can get sniped by
migrate_pages_batch() at the same time that we are holding the notifier
lock to mark the pages as accessed/dirty, but at this point we also want
to grab the folio locks(s) to mark them as dirty, but if they are
contended from notifier/migrate_pages_batch side then we deadlock since
folio lock won't be dropped until we drop the notifier lock.

Fortunately the mark_page_accessed/dirty is not really needed in the
first place it seems and should have already been done by hmm fault, so
just remove it.

Lucas De Marchi
6405f5b70b drm/xe: Set LRC addresses before guc load
The metadata saved in the ADS is read by GuC when it's initialized.
Saving the addresses to the LRCs when they are populated is too late as
GuC will keep using the old ones.

This was causing GuC to use the RCS LRC for any engine class. It's not a
big problem on a Linux-only scenario since the they are used by GuC only
on media engines when the watchdog is triggered. However, in a
virtualization scenario with Windows as the VF, it causes the wrong LRCs
to be loaded as the watchdog is used for all engines.

Fix it by letting guc_golden_lrc_init() initialize the metadata, like
other *_init() functions, and later guc_golden_lrc_populate() to copy
the LRCs to the right places. The former is called before the second GuC
load, while the latter is called after LRCs have been recorded.

Ojaswin Mujoo
ccad447a3d ext4: make block validity check resistent to sb bh corruption
Block validity checks need to be skipped in case they are called
for journal blocks since they are part of system's protected
zone.

Currently, this is done by checking inode->ino against
sbi->s_es->s_journal_inum, which is a direct read from the ext4 sb
buffer head. If someone modifies this underneath us then the
s_journal_inum field might get corrupted. To prevent against this,
change the check to directly compare the inode with journal->j_inode.

**Slight change in behavior**: During journal init path,
check_block_validity etc might be called for journal inode when
sbi->s_journal is not set yet. In this case we now proceed with
ext4_inode_block_valid() instead of returning early. Since systems zones
have not been set yet, it is okay to proceed so we can perform basic
checks on the blocks.

7cdabafc00 Merge tag 'trace-v6.15-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/trace/linux-trace
Pull tracing fixes from Steven Rostedt:

 - Hide get_vm_area() from MMUless builds

   The function get_vm_area() is not defined when CONFIG_MMU is not
   defined. Hide that function within #ifdef CONFIG_MMU.

 - Fix output of synthetic events when they have dynamic strings

   The print fmt of the synthetic event's format file use to have "%.*s"
   for dynamic size strings even though the user space exported
   arguments had only __get_str() macro that provided just a nul
   terminated string. This was fixed so that user space could parse this
   properly.

   But the reason that it had "%.*s" was because internally it provided
   the maximum size of the string as one of the arguments. The fix that
   replaced "%.*s" with "%s" caused the trace output (when the kernel
   reads the event) to write "(efault)" as it would now read the length
   of the string as "%s".

   As the string provided is always nul terminated, there's no reason
   for the internal code to use "%.*s" anyway. Just remove the length
   argument to match the "%s" that is now in the format.

 - Fix the ftrace subops hash logic of the manager ops hash

   The function_graph uses the ftrace subops code. The subops code is a
   way to have a single ftrace_ops registered with ftrace to determine
   what functions will call the ftrace_ops callback. More than one user
   of function graph can register a ftrace_ops with it. The function
   graph infrastructure will then add this ftrace_ops as a subops with
   the main ftrace_ops it registers with ftrace. This is because the
   functions will always call the function graph callback which in turn
   calls the subops ftrace_ops callbacks.

   The main ftrace_ops must add a callback to all the functions that the
   subops want a callback from. When a subops is registered, it will
   update the main ftrace_ops hash to include the functions it wants.
   This is the logic that was broken.

   The ftrace_ops hash has a "filter_hash" and a "notrace_hash" where
   all the functions in the filter_hash but not in the notrace_hash are
   attached by ftrace. The original logic would have the main ftrace_ops
   filter_hash be a union of all the subops filter_hashes and the main
   notrace_hash would be a intersect of all the subops filter hashes.
   But this was incorrect because the notrace hash depends on the
   filter_hash it is associated to and not the union of all
   filter_hashes.

   Instead, when a subops is added, just include all the functions of
   the subops hash that are in its filter_hash but not in its
   notrace_hash. The main subops hash should not use its notrace hash,
   unless all of its subops hashes have an empty filter_hash (which
   means to attach to all functions), and then, and only then, the main
   ftrace_ops notrace hash can be the intersect of all the subops
   hashes.

   This not only fixes the bug, but also simplifies the code.

 - Add a selftest to better test the subops filtering

   Add a selftest that would catch the bug fixed by the above change.

 - Fix extra newline printed in function tracing with retval

   The function parameter code changed the output logic slightly and
   called print_graph_retval() and also printed a newline. The
   print_graph_retval() also prints a newline which caused blank lines
   to be printed in the function graph tracer when retval was added.
   This caused one of the selftests to fail if retvals were enabled.
   Instead remove the new line output from print_graph_retval() and have
   the callers always print the new line so that it doesn't have to do
   special logic if it calls print_graph_retval() or not.

 - Fix out-of-bound memory access in the runtime verifier

   When rv_is_container_monitor() is called on the last entry on the
   link list it references the next entry, which is the list head and
   causes an out-of-bound memory access.

Steven Rostedt
485acd207d ftrace: Do not have print_graph_retval() add a newline
The retval and retaddr options for function_graph tracer will add a
comment at the end of a function for both leaf and non leaf functions that
looks like:

               __wake_up_common(); /* ret=0x1 */

               } /* pick_next_task_fair ret=0x0 */

The function print_graph_retval() adds a newline after the "*/". But if
that's not called, the caller function needs to make sure there's a
newline added.

This is confusing and when the function parameters code was added, it
added a newline even when calling print_graph_retval() as the fact that
the print_graph_retval() function prints a newline isn't obvious.

This caused an extra newline to be printed and that made it fail the
selftests when the retval option was set, as the selftests were not
expecting blank lines being injected into the trace.

Instead of having print_graph_retval() print a newline, just have the
caller always print the newline regardless if it calls print_graph_retval()
or not. This not only fixes this bug, but it also simplifies the code.

Steven Rostedt
0ae6b8ce20 ftrace: Fix accounting of subop hashes
The function graph infrastructure uses ftrace to hook to functions. It has
a single ftrace_ops to manage all the users of function graph. Each
individual user (tracing, bpf, fprobes, etc) has its own ftrace_ops to
track the functions it will have its callback called from. These
ftrace_ops are "subops" to the main ftrace_ops of the function graph
infrastructure.

Each ftrace_ops has a filter_hash and a notrace_hash that is defined as:

  Only trace functions that are in the filter_hash but not in the
  notrace_hash.

If the filter_hash is empty, it means to trace all functions.
If the notrace_hash is empty, it means do not disable any function.

The function graph main ftrace_ops needs to be a superset containing all
the functions to be traced by all the subops it has. The algorithm to
perform this merge was incorrect.

When the first subops was added to the main ops, it simply made the main
ops a copy of the subops (same filter_hash and notrace_hash).

When a second ops was added, it joined the new subops filter_hash with the
main ops filter_hash as a union of the two sets. The intersect between the
new subops notrace_hash and the main ops notrace_hash was created as the
new notrace_hash of the main ops.

The issue here is that it would then start tracing functions than no
subops were tracing. For example if you had two subops that had:

subops 1:

  filter_hash = '*sched*' # trace all functions with "sched" in it
  notrace_hash = '*time*' # except do not trace functions with "time"

subops 2:

  filter_hash = '*lock*' # trace all functions with "lock" in it
  notrace_hash = '*clock*' # except do not trace functions with "clock"

The intersect of '*time*' functions with '*clock*' functions could be the
empty set. That means the main ops will be tracing all functions with
'*time*' and all "*clock*" in it!

Instead, modify the algorithm to be a bit simpler and correct.

First, when adding a new subops, even if it's the first one, do not add
the notrace_hash if the filter_hash is not empty. Instead, just add the
functions that are in the filter_hash of the subops but not in the
notrace_hash of the subops into the main ops filter_hash. There's no
reason to add anything to the main ops notrace_hash.

The notrace_hash of the main ops should only be non empty iff all subops
filter_hashes are empty (meaning to trace all functions) and all subops
notrace_hashes include the same functions.

That is, the main ops notrace_hash is empty if any subops filter_hash is
non empty.

The main ops notrace_hash only has content in it if all subops
filter_hashes are empty, and the content are only functions that intersect
all the subops notrace_hashes. If any subops notrace_hash is empty, then
so is the main ops notrace_hash.

Zhangfei Gao
c8ba3f8aff PCI: Run quirk_huawei_pcie_sva() before arm_smmu_probe_device()
quirk_huawei_pcie_sva() sets properties needed by arm_smmu_probe_device(),
but bcb81ac6ae ("iommu: Get DT/ACPI parsing into the proper probe path")
changed the iommu_probe_device() flow so arm_smmu_probe_device() is now
invoked before the quirk, leading to failures like this:

  reg-dummy reg-dummy: late IOMMU probe at driver bind, something fishy here!
  WARNING: CPU: 0 PID: 1 at drivers/iommu/iommu.c:449 __iommu_probe_device+0x140/0x570
  RIP: 0010:__iommu_probe_device+0x140/0x570

The SR-IOV enumeration ordering changes like this:

  pci_iov_add_virtfn
    pci_device_add
      pci_fixup_device(pci_fixup_header)      <--
      device_add
        bus_notify
          iommu_bus_notifier
  +         iommu_probe_device
  +           arm_smmu_probe_device
    pci_bus_add_device
      pci_fixup_device(pci_fixup_final)       <--
      device_attach
        driver_probe_device
          really_probe
            pci_dma_configure
              acpi_dma_configure_id
  -             iommu_probe_device
  -               arm_smmu_probe_device

The non-SR-IOV case is similar in that pci_device_add() is called from
pci_scan_single_device() in the generic enumeration path and
pci_bus_add_device() is called later, after all host bridges have been
enumerated.

Declare quirk_huawei_pcie_sva() as a header fixup to ensure that it happens
before arm_smmu_probe_device().

Kumar Kartikeya Dwivedi
a650d38915 bpf: Convert ringbuf map to rqspinlock
Convert the raw spinlock used by BPF ringbuf to rqspinlock. Currently,
we have an open syzbot report of a potential deadlock. In addition, the
ringbuf can fail to reserve spuriously under contention from NMI
context.

It is potentially attractive to enable unconstrained usage (incl. NMIs)
while ensuring no deadlocks manifest at runtime, perform the conversion
to rqspinlock to achieve this.

This change was benchmarked for BPF ringbuf's multi-producer contention
case on an Intel Sapphire Rapids server, with hyperthreading disabled
and performance governor turned on. 5 warm up runs were done for each
case before obtaining the results.

Before (raw_spinlock_t):

Ringbuf, multi-producer contention
==================================
rb-libbpf nr_prod 1  11.440 ± 0.019M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 2  2.706 ± 0.010M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 3  3.130 ± 0.004M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 4  2.472 ± 0.003M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 8  2.352 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 12 2.813 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 16 1.988 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 20 2.245 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 24 2.148 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 28 2.190 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 32 2.490 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 36 2.180 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 40 2.201 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 44 2.226 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 48 2.164 ± 0.001M/s (drops 0.000 ± 0.000M/s)
rb-libbpf nr_prod 52 1.874 ± 0.001M/s (drops 0.000 ± 0.000M/s)

After (rqspinlock_t):

Ringbuf, multi-producer contention
==================================
rb-libbpf nr_prod 1  11.078 ± 0.019M/s (drops 0.000 ± 0.000M/s) (-3.16%)
rb-libbpf nr_prod 2  2.801 ± 0.014M/s (drops 0.000 ± 0.000M/s) (3.51%)
rb-libbpf nr_prod 3  3.454 ± 0.005M/s (drops 0.000 ± 0.000M/s) (10.35%)
rb-libbpf nr_prod 4  2.567 ± 0.002M/s (drops 0.000 ± 0.000M/s) (3.84%)
rb-libbpf nr_prod 8  2.468 ± 0.001M/s (drops 0.000 ± 0.000M/s) (4.93%)
rb-libbpf nr_prod 12 2.510 ± 0.001M/s (drops 0.000 ± 0.000M/s) (-10.77%)
rb-libbpf nr_prod 16 2.075 ± 0.001M/s (drops 0.000 ± 0.000M/s) (4.38%)
rb-libbpf nr_prod 20 2.640 ± 0.001M/s (drops 0.000 ± 0.000M/s) (17.59%)
rb-libbpf nr_prod 24 2.092 ± 0.001M/s (drops 0.000 ± 0.000M/s) (-2.61%)
rb-libbpf nr_prod 28 2.426 ± 0.005M/s (drops 0.000 ± 0.000M/s) (10.78%)
rb-libbpf nr_prod 32 2.331 ± 0.004M/s (drops 0.000 ± 0.000M/s) (-6.39%)
rb-libbpf nr_prod 36 2.306 ± 0.003M/s (drops 0.000 ± 0.000M/s) (5.78%)
rb-libbpf nr_prod 40 2.178 ± 0.002M/s (drops 0.000 ± 0.000M/s) (-1.04%)
rb-libbpf nr_prod 44 2.293 ± 0.001M/s (drops 0.000 ± 0.000M/s) (3.01%)
rb-libbpf nr_prod 48 2.022 ± 0.001M/s (drops 0.000 ± 0.000M/s) (-6.56%)
rb-libbpf nr_prod 52 1.809 ± 0.001M/s (drops 0.000 ± 0.000M/s) (-3.47%)

There's a fair amount of noise in the benchmark, with numbers on reruns
going up and down by 10%, so all changes are in the range of this
disturbance, and we see no major regressions.
